  9. Hi, played a great game Tuesday against Jack Daw, and he dumped firing squad injustice on my Rail Golem, this raised a question- Firing squad injustice causes damage when the model 'declares an attack action', when I use Locomotion to make a melee attack, I declare a tactical action (locomotion) which then leads to a ML attack (rail bash), would people think this follows <A> or <B> below- A> declare a (0)tactical action (locomotion), lower burning condition, choose to make a free (1)ML attack (rail bash), bash montressor, potentially repeat as triggers get involved etc or B> declare a (0)tactical action (locomotion), lower burning condition, choose to make a free (1) ML attack (rail bash), Declare the (1) Melee action (rail bash) take 2 damage from Firing squad Injustice, bash Montressor, potentially repeat as triggers get involved including any more damage caused by the injustice After a discussion with the other players around it was decided to go with (a) as the rail golem is declaring a tactical action, which just happens to allow a ML attack, rather than declaring an Attack action, but I was interested in hearing others opinions (I hate feeling like I may have got something wrong, especially if it was in my favour, as then I keep thinking that maybe I cheated...)

  15. hi, this is probably a silly question, but I'm just starting to get to grips with Ramos, and the wording on the ability that allows him to summon the steam arachnids has me a little confused. the target number is 10(+3(tome)) for each arachnid I want to summon, does this mean the target numbers are:- 1 arachnid=13(tome) 2 arachnids=16(tome) 3 arachnids=19(tome) or 1 arachnid=13(tome) 2 arachnids=16(tome)(tome) 3 arachnids=19(tome)(tome)(tome) I played it version 2 last game, but if it is that way, where on earth do I get the third tome from? (one on my Ca. one on the card, the last one?) Cheers Mick
